Improper Sizing of A/c Unit



Stay clear of purchasing a cooling device that's either also large or as well tiny for your area to avoid inadequacy and potential problems over time. Performance concerns arise when the air conditioner unit is large, resulting in regular biking on and off, which not only wastes energy but also puts on down the parts faster. On the other hand, a small unit battles to cool down the area appropriately, causing efficiency concerns like unequal temperatures and boosted power usage as it works harder to reach the wanted temperature.



To ensure reliable performance, it's crucial to select a cooling unit that's the ideal size for your specific location. Consulting with a professional to perform a tons computation based on variables like square video footage, insulation, and sunlight direct exposure can aid identify the proper size for your demands. By avoiding the challenges of inappropriate sizing, you can enjoy a comfortable setting while keeping power expenses in check.



Wrong Placement of Outdoor Device



Inaccurately putting the outdoor system of your air conditioning system can lead to decreased performance and potential performance problems. When determining where to mount your outside device, take into consideration the following:




  1. Outdoor Device Place: The exterior unit ought to be placed in a well-ventilated location where there's lots of air movement. Stay clear of positioning it in straight sunlight or near to warmth sources, as this can create the device to overheat and function tougher to cool your home.


  2. Landscaping Factors to consider: Confirm that the outside system is without any landscape design that might obstruct air flow. Trim back bushes, plants, and trees to create at least 2 feet of clearance around the system. This will certainly assist prevent particles from entering the system and obstructing its function.


  3. Altitude: Place the outdoor system on a level surface to stop water merging inside the device. Appropriate water drainage is critical for the system to function effectively and prevent water damage.


  4. Ease of access: Position the exterior system in an area that's easily obtainable for maintenance and repairs. Avoid tight rooms or areas that are challenging to get to, as this can make servicing the system much more challenging and expensive in the future.

Ductwork Product Condition



Evaluating the condition of your ductwork material is important to making sure peak efficiency and performance in your a/c system. Neglecting ductwork upkeep can cause air leakages, inadequate air movement, and enhanced energy intake. In time, ducts can wear away, triggering splits, holes, or detached joints that permit cooled down air to get away prior to reaching your space. https://goldersgreenacinstallation.co.uk It is very important to look for any kind of signs of damages and address them promptly to keep excellent system capability.



In addition, examining the insulation products surrounding your ductwork is very important. Harmed or inadequate insulation can lead to energy loss and lowered cooling down efficiency. By guaranteeing your ductwork is well-kept and correctly insulated, you can boost the efficiency and longevity of your cooling system.

Failing to Schedule Normal Maintenance



Disregarding to schedule routine maintenance for your a/c system can cause lowered efficiency and possible failures. Without a proper upkeep schedule in position, your air conditioning device may accumulate dust and particles, creating it to work tougher to cool your home. With time, this can lead to reduced power efficiency, greater electricity costs, and a much shorter lifespan for your system.



By neglecting routine maintenance, you're additionally taking the chance of unforeseen breakdowns throughout the peak of summertime when your a/c system is functioning its hardest. These abrupt failures can leave you without amazing air in the sweltering heat, bring about pain and potentially costly fixings.



To protect the long-term efficiency and performance of your cooling system, it's necessary to focus on regular maintenance. Arrange annual tune-ups with an expert a/c specialist to tidy and examine your device, identify any potential issues early on, and maintain your system running smoothly. Buying upkeep now can save you from larger troubles in the future and aid your a/c system operate at its best.
